    I’ve been eying gallery wraps for a long time and have just never put in the order. You’re pretty happy with it then? If this was from your trip a couple months ago this was with your XTI correct? I’m just curious if my 8mp xt can handle a print that big… Some of the sites warn me about the quality degrading when I push the envelope.

  2. Brett Maxwell Says:

    Yes, this was with a 10mp XTi, but, it’s actually about 8 vertical frames merged together. The final resolution was 20 some megapixels, and is great for showing the small details. However, I still think 8mp will make good large prints, especially canvas which is more forgiving. Look at my 20×30 in the Riverview gallery, that is 10mp and at ISO 1600, and I think it still looks pretty good. It has a lot to do with viewing distance; you don’t stand as close to a 20×30 as you do an 8×10 when you’re looking at them on the wall.
